Nine Indian fishermen apprehended by Sri Lankan Navy
Pudukkottai (Tamil Nadu) [India], Aug 8 (ANI): Nine Indian fishermen were apprehended by the Sri Lankan Navy along with two boats from the Palk Strait area.
